How Does Condensation in Microwaves Occur?
Condensation in microwaves is a common problem that can lead to surface damage and affect the longevity of the appliance. Understanding how condensation occurs in microwaves is essential for effectively preventing and reducing its occurrence. During the cooking process, moisture is released as water vapor, which rises and hits the cooler surfaces of the microwave walls. This collision between the vapor and the cooler surfaces causes condensation to form, resulting in water droplets on the walls and ceiling of the microwave.
This condensation can be problematic as it can lead to surface damage and wear down the interior coating of the microwave over time. The markings or rust that can result from condensation can not only be unsightly but also impact the overall performance and safety of the appliance. Therefore, it is important to take preventive measures to minimize condensation and protect your microwave.
By implementing simple practices like covering food, using microwave-safe containers, and stirring or mixing the food during microwaving intervals, you can reduce condensation. These practices help to evenly distribute the heat, reduce the intensity of cooking, and retain moisture in the food, preventing excessive condensation from occurring. Additionally, regularly wiping down the walls of the microwave with a dry, soft cloth or tissue after each use and leaving the door open for ventilation and evaporation can help prevent condensation buildup and prolong the life of your microwave.
Tips to Reduce Condensation in Your Microwave
If you’re tired of dealing with condensation in your microwave, there are several simple tips you can follow to reduce this common issue. By implementing these preventive measures, you can keep your microwave in better condition and extend its longevity.
Lower the Power Setting
One effective way to reduce condensation in your microwave is to lower the power setting. By reducing the intensity of cooking, you can minimize the amount of moisture released as water vapor, which in turn lowers the chances of condensation forming on the walls of your microwave. Experiment with different power levels to find the right balance for your cooking needs.
Stir or Mix the Food
Another helpful tip is to stir or mix the food during microwaving intervals. By doing so, you ensure that the heat is evenly distributed, reducing the likelihood of hot spots that can lead to excessive condensation. This simple action promotes more even cooking and helps prevent moisture from accumulating on the walls of your microwave.
Use Microwave-Safe Containers
Choosing the right containers for microwaving can also make a difference in reducing condensation. Opt for microwave-safe containers that are designed to retain moisture within the food. By preventing excessive moisture from escaping and covering the walls of your microwave, you can significantly decrease condensation.

The Importance of Cleaning to Prevent Condensation
Regular cleaning is essential in preventing condensation buildup in your microwave. By taking the time to wipe down the walls and surfaces after each use, you can eliminate any moisture that may have accumulated. This simple step can go a long way in maintaining the performance and longevity of your appliance.
When cleaning your microwave, it is important to use a dry, soft cloth or tissue. Avoid using wet or damp cloths, as this can introduce more moisture into the microwave and exacerbate the condensation problem. Gently wipe down the walls, paying close attention to areas where condensation tends to collect, such as around the door and vents.
In addition to wiping down the interior, it is also beneficial to leave the microwave door open for a few minutes after cleaning. This allows for proper ventilation and helps to evaporate any residual moisture. By doing so, you can effectively reduce the chances of condensation occurring during future use.
Remember to always unplug your microwave before cleaning, and avoid using harsh chemicals or abrasive materials that could damage the appliance. Taking the time to properly clean and maintain your microwave will not only help prevent condensation but also ensure it continues to function optimally for years to come.
Product | Description |
---|---|
Vinegar | Mix equal parts vinegar and water to create a natural cleaning solution. Wipe down the interior with a cloth soaked in the mixture to remove stains and odors. |
Baking Soda | Sprinkle baking soda on a damp cloth and gently scrub the interior surfaces. This can help remove tough stains and eliminate odors. |
Dish Soap | Mix a few drops of dish soap with warm water. Use a sponge or cloth to scrub the interior, then rinse thoroughly to remove any soap residue. |
Lemon Juice | Squeeze fresh lemon juice into a bowl of water. Dip a cloth or sponge in the solution and wipe down the interior surfaces. Lemon juice can help remove stains and leave behind a fresh scent. |

Additional Suggestions for Preventing Condensation
Aside from the tips mentioned earlier, there are a few more suggestions you can follow to further prevent condensation in your microwave. These suggestions will help you maintain the performance of your appliance and reduce the chances of facing the microwave condensation problem.
Use Microwave-Safe Covers
One effective way to prevent condensation is by using microwave-safe covers. These covers come in various forms, such as lids, wax paper, paper towels, or plastic wrap. By covering your food during the cooking process, you can retain moisture and reduce the chances of it escaping and condensing on the microwave walls. This not only helps in preventing condensation but also shortens the cooking time and reduces spattering.
Vent Steam
A common cause of condensation in microwaves is the build-up of steam. To mitigate this, you can vent the steam by folding back a corner of the plastic wrap or using microwave-safe lids with built-in vents. Venting allows the steam to escape, preventing it from accumulating on the walls of the microwave and reducing condensation.

Prevention Tips for Over-the-Range Microwaves
If you have an over-the-range microwave, you may have experienced condensation buildup on the door and cavity. This can be caused by high moisture content foods that release steam during the cooking process. To prevent condensation in your over-the-range microwave, follow these tips:
1. Wipe off moisture
After using your microwave, it’s important to wipe off any moisture that has accumulated on the door and cavity. Use a soft cloth or paper towel to gently remove the condensation. This simple step can help prevent moisture from lingering and causing issues.
2. Let the door stand open
Allowing the microwave door to stand open for approximately 15 minutes after use can help accelerate the dissipation of moisture. This allows any remaining condensation to evaporate, reducing the chances of it causing damage or buildup inside the microwave.
3. Use proper ventilation
Proper ventilation is crucial for preventing condensation in over-the-range microwaves. Ensure that the ventilation system in your kitchen is working effectively and that the microwave has enough space around it for proper airflow. Ventilation helps to remove excess moisture from the cooking process, reducing the chances of condensation.
